『壹』 有能在Android系統上運行的c語言編程軟體嗎,推薦一下
C4droid是一款專為Android設備設計的C/C++程序編譯器,它默認使用tcc(Tiny C Compiler)作為編譯器。用戶可以根據需求選擇安裝GCC插件,不過需要注意的是,GCC插件僅對root用戶開放,其大小約為20MB。安裝了GCC插件後,可以利用SDL(簡單直控媒體層庫)和Qt(諾基亞官方開發庫)進行開發。這兩個庫都需要額外安裝SDL插件才能使用。此外,C4droid還支持開發原生Android應用程序,這與Google NDK的開發方式非常相似。
在C4droid中,代碼高亮功能使得編程更加清晰直觀,而編譯速度則取決於CPU主頻,主頻越高,編譯速度越快。目前,GCC插件的版本為4.7.2,它包含了一系列示常式序,其中包括SDL、Android Native、Qt以及命令行測試程序的源代碼。這些示常式序對於初學者來說非常有幫助,可以幫助他們快速上手C/C++編程。
在使用C4droid時,用戶可以根據自己的需求選擇不同的編譯器和開發庫,從而實現多樣化的開發目標。無論是進行簡單的程序開發,還是開發復雜的Android應用,C4droid都能提供強大的支持。對於那些希望在Android設備上進行C/C++編程的開發者來說,C4droid無疑是一個非常實用的選擇。
通過C4droid,開發者可以充分利用Android設備的硬體資源,實現高性能的程序開發。無論是進行系統級別的開發,還是開發游戲或工具應用,C4droid都能提供強大的支持。此外,C4droid還提供了豐富的示常式序,幫助開發者快速掌握C/C++編程技巧,從而提高開發效率。
總之,C4droid是一款功能強大的C/C++編譯器,它不僅支持多種開發庫,還提供了豐富的示常式序,使得開發者能夠更加高效地進行C/C++編程。對於那些希望在Android設備上進行C/C++開發的用戶來說,C4droid無疑是一個值得推薦的選擇。
『貳』 有什麼手機上的編程軟體 手機編程軟體有哪些
有什麼手機上的編程軟體?NO.
1 c4droid一款手機上的c語言編譯器。個人認為手機上最好用的,沒有之一!c4droid是款Android設備上的C/C++程序編譯器。NO.
2 AIDE功能強大,內置學習教程。AIDE是一個Android java集成開發環境,可以讓你在Android系統內進行Android軟體和游戲的開發。
mind 編程軟體手機版?
Mind編程軟體手機版是一款非常專業且優秀的青少年編程軟體,通過這款軟體,可幫助青少年用戶快速學習編程,該軟體擁有自主知識產權,擁有各種主流的主控板以及其它的開源硬體,提供多種多樣的電子模塊,一鍵即可進行添加,還可一鍵安裝常用的硬體驅動,基於Scratch3.0開發,支持人工智慧,同時支持物聯網功能,可拖動圖形化積木編程,還可使用其它不同的高級編程語言。
有沒有能直接在手機上面使用的編程軟體?
可以在手機上編程的app,分別是:java,Android:AIDE集成開發環境。,c語言編譯器、C4droid。
1、java和Android:AIDE集成開發環境。
2、.C語言:c語言編譯器、C4droid。
3、.python:QPython3、Termux。
4、CSS/HTML/JavaScript:HTMLplay。
大部分都不需要root,可以直接編寫程序並運行。
對於app的具體要求:
手機上能學編程、寫代碼的app還是一個比較籠統的要求。具體來說,選擇app時還有以下更細致的要求:
第一條,無論安卓手機或iphone、ipad 等蘋果設備都能使用。
第二條,除了寫代碼,還能實現學習編程。
第三條,能支持自己想要學習的編程語言。
第四條,有語法高亮、有自動縮進等等語法標記。
第五條,能運行代碼,並且和電腦一樣有清晰的報錯提醒,方便我們修正代碼中的錯誤。
其它答主提供的選擇,要麼僅僅支持安卓手機,要麼編程語言也僅限 C/C++,甚至有答主說手機想要支持其它高級編程語言比如 python 會很困難。這令我很意外,我在用的這個app就可以支持python啊。
還有像iapp這么好玩的編程應用嗎?要能在安卓手機上用的?
AndroLua+androlua是基於開源項目lua開發的輕型腳本編程工具,使用簡潔優美的lua語言,簡化了繁瑣的Java語句,同時支持使用大部分安卓api.
AndroLuaJAndroLuaJ集成JAVA環境、Lua環境和C/C++環境,支持NDK,支持java、lua、C/C++的編譯運行,它可以在手機端快速打包apk。
APPlua+APP yy lua+是一款lua語言的開發工具 內置打包,調試,手冊,等功能。
以上三個app是我在 酷安 找的,編輯工具,集成開發環境,即IDE。支持AndroidLua語言(具體沒測試過,前兩個app口碑還可以,第三個沒聽說)
然後就是iAppiapp3.0公測版下載
iApp3.0採用3種編程語言,切可混合編程開發,需測試其中的語言穩定性,代碼BUG,代碼編寫方式與代碼提示等。
ijs語言 -基於js語法,支持js所有語法,同時融合裕語言代碼。
lua語言 -基於luajava語法,支持lua和luajava的語法,同時融合裕語言代碼。
iyu語言 -iapp開發團隊開發的基於java語言的一個腳本語言(裕語言)。
接著AIDEAIDE官方網站aide是一個Android Java集成開發環境,可以在Android系統內進行Android軟體和游戲的開發。應該是目前手機端最強大的Android java集成開發環境。比較好用,而且支持pc端的java 代碼及Android項目,和開源庫。
學習編程和手機游戲製作用什麼軟體?
手機游戲現在主流平台是ios(蘋果)和Android(安卓):
1、iOS(蘋果) 開發語言如C++,ObjectC等
2、Android(安卓) 開發語言是Java(J2ME) 對於你的建議是: 1、先打好編程基礎 建議直接學習C語言,C是最好的入門語言,而且你的數學水平達到學習C的要求了。認真學習它,學這個是需要時間的,尤其是指針(C的精髓)要掌握。 2、學好這個以後,可以根據你個人的興趣選擇一個開發平台去學習。 喜歡蘋果就去學C++,喜歡安卓就學Java。 學這兩種語言都要下苦功夫。
3、語言基礎打牢,就可以學習手機游戲開發,如建模等等知識了!
C++可以編寫哪些手機系統的軟體?
C4droidC4droid是一個C / C + + IDE + C / C + +編譯器,GNU Makefile文件,SDL和Qt支持的Android。 C4droid支持ARM處理器(而不是設備與英特爾的x86和MIPS處理器)的設備。您可以創建自己的應用程序在Android手機中,運行(即使沒有上網:編譯器為離線狀態)和出口的可執行文件(為終端的應用程序)或APK(GUI使用的應用程序)。
此應用程序使用TCC和uClibc(GCC仿生libc的一個插件),所以它有完整的ANSI C和ISO C99支持。 C4droid可用於教育目的或在C和C + +語言的練習。C4droid支持語法高亮,代碼完成和源代碼格式,所以它是一個非常方便的工具,在旅途中進行編程。
我是作加工中心的,有沒有一種手機軟體可以自動編程,比如把圖紙拍下了能不能自動編程?
自動編程軟體有,但是和你想的那種不一樣。它是利用計算機專用軟體來編制數控加工程序。編程人員只需根據零件圖樣的要求,使用數控語言,由計算機自動地進行數值計算及後置處理,編寫出零件加工程序單,加工程序通過直接通信的方式送入數控機床,指揮機床工作。完全不用干預的應該沒有。
『叄』 有沒有能直接在手機上面使用的編程軟體
手機上的編程軟體有c4droid、aide、CppDroid、QPython3、Termux。
相關介紹:
1、c4droid:
是款Android設備上的C/C++程序IDE。默認以tcc(tiny c compiler)為編譯器,可以選擇安裝gcc插件(20mb,只有root用戶可以使用),選用gcc後,可以用sdl(簡單直控媒體層庫,需安裝sdl plugin for c4droid)和qt(nokia官方開發庫。
4、QPython3:
主要用來在手機上寫python3代碼,主界面如下,主要分為「終端」、「編輯器」、「程序」、「QPYPI」、「課程」、「社區」這6個模塊,終端類似IDLE,編輯器類似記事本,QPYPI是第三方包和工具。
5、Termux:
Termux是一個Android下一個高級的終端模擬器, 開源且不需要root, 支持apt管理軟體包,十分方便安裝軟體包, 完美支持Python、PHP、Ruby、Go, Nodejs、MySQL等。
『肆』 瀛Android寮鍙戠殑宀椾綅鏈夊摢浜涳紵
Android寮鍙戠浉鍏寵亴浣嶈亴璐e強瑕佹眰錛岃繖閲屾矙娌沖寳澶ч潚楦焌ndroid鍩硅鑰佸笀緇欐垜浠鏁寸悊浜嗗備笅鍑犱釜宀椾綅銆
涓.Android寮鍙戝伐紼嬪笀
宀椾綅鑱岃矗錛
1銆丄ndroid鏅鴻兘鎵嬫満騫沖彴搴旂敤杞浠剁殑鍒嗘瀽銆佽捐°佺紪鐮佸拰嫻嬭瘯
2銆佹櫤鑳芥墜鏈哄簲鐢ㄧ浉鍏崇殑鎶鏈鐮旂┒
3銆佷粠浜嬩笌鍟嗗搧鍖栫浉鍏崇殑鎶鏈鏀鎸
浠昏亴璧勬牸錛
1銆佽$畻鏈恆侀氫俊銆佺數瀛愮瓑鐩稿叧涓撲笟鏈縐戜互涓婂﹀巻錛屼竴騫翠互涓婂伐浣滅粡楠
2銆佺啛鎮塋inux鎿嶄綔緋葷粺
3銆佸叿鏈塉2ME鎴朖ava寮鍙戠粡楠岋紝鐔熸倝ANDROID鎵嬫満杞浠舵灦鏋勶紝鐔熸倝Android騫沖彴MMI杞浠跺紑鍙
4銆佷簡瑙e熀鏈杞浠跺紑鍙戞祦紼嬶紝浜嗚ВClearCase/ClearQuest/UML絳夊紑鍙戝伐鍏
5銆佸叿鏈夎壇濂界殑鑻辨枃鏂囨。緙栧啓鑳藉姏
絎﹀悎浠ヤ笅鏉′歡鑰呬紭鍏堬細
-鏈夋櫤鑳芥墜鏈哄紑鍙戠粡楠岃呬紭鍏
-鏈塋inux鎵嬫満騫沖彴寮鍙戠粡楠岃呬紭鍏
1銆佽$畻鏈虹浉鍏充笓涓氭瘯涓氥
2銆佷袱騫翠互涓婂祵鍏ュ紡緋葷粺寮鍙戠粡楠岋紝涓騫翠互涓婄殑ANDROID鎵嬫満騫沖彴緇忛獙銆
3銆佽佹眰鐔熸倝ANDROID鎵嬫満杞浠舵灦鏋勶紝綺鵑欰NDROID騫沖彴MMI杞浠跺紑鍙戱紝鑳界嫭絝嬭繘琛屽簲鐢ㄧ▼搴忓紑鍙戝拰縐繪嶃
4銆佽佹眰鐔熸倝鍩烘湰鏃犵嚎鍗忚(濡傦細GSM/GPRS/CDMA鍜孲DL)銆
5銆佸枩嬈㈡寫鎴橀珮闅懼害欏圭洰銆
6銆佹湁杈冨ソ鐨勫︿範鑳藉姏銆佹矡閫氳兘鍔涳紝鑳芥壙鍙椾竴瀹氱殑宸ヤ綔鍘嬪姏銆
7銆佸叿澶囪壇濂藉悎浣滄佸害鍙婂洟闃熺簿紲烇紝騫跺瘜鏈夊伐浣滄縺鎯呫佸壋鏂板姏鍜岃矗浠繪劅銆
浜.Android杞浠跺紑鍙戝伐紼嬪笀
鑱屼綅鎻忚堪錛
1.Android鎵嬫満搴旂敤杞浠惰捐;
2.Android鎵嬫満搴旂敤杞浠跺紑鍙;
3.Android鎵嬫満杞浠跺姛鑳芥祴璇曚笌楠岃瘉;
浠昏亴瑕佹眰錛
1.鎺屾彙Android騫沖彴搴旂敤杞浠跺紑鍙戞妧鏈;
2.鐔熸倝AdodbAIR緙栫▼鎶鏈鑰呬紭鍏堣冭檻;
3.鐔熸倝c++/Java緙栫▼鎶鏈;
4.鎺屾彙Android緋葷粺緗戠粶緙栫▼鑳藉姏;
5.Android緋葷粺杞浠跺紑鍙戜竴騫翠互涓婂伐浣滅粡楠岃呬紭鍏堣冭檻;
6.宸ヤ綔縐鏋併佽ょ湡銆佸埢鑻︼紝鍏鋒湁鑹濂界殑鍥㈤槦鍚堜綔綺劇炪
涓.Android搴旂敤寮鍙戝伐紼嬪笀
鑱屼綅鎻忚堪:
璐熻矗Android騫沖彴涓嬪簲鐢ㄧ殑寮鍙戙
鑱屼綅瑕佹眰錛
1銆佽$畻鏈烘垨鐩稿叧鎶鏈涓撲笟鐨勬湰縐戝強浠ヤ笂瀛︿綅(鎴栧悓絳夊﹀巻);
2銆佷赴瀵岀殑C錛孋++鎴朖ava鐨勭紪鐮佹妧鑳;
3銆佸硅蔣浠朵駭鍝佹湁寮虹儓鐨勮矗浠誨績;
4銆佺儹鐖辮捐$紪鍐欑▼搴忥紝瀵笽T琛屼笟鍏呮弧嬋鎯咃紝鏈夌嫭絝嬬殑鐢ㄤ唬鐮佽В鍐抽棶棰樼殑鑳藉姏;
5銆佺啛鎮堿ndroid搴旂敤寮鍙戞嗘灦錛岃兘鐙絝嬪紑鍙戦珮鎬ц兘鐨凙ndroid搴旂敤;
6銆佺啛鎮堿ndroid騫沖彴鏋舵瀯錛屾湁Android婧愮爜浜屾″紑鍙戠粡楠岃呬紭鍏;
7銆佹湁APP浣滃搧鑰呬紭鍏堛